Materials Needed to Clean Your LG Smart TV Screen
Before you start cleaning your LG Smart TV screen, make sure you have the following materials:
- Microfiber Cloth: A microfiber cloth is the best material to clean your LG Smart TV screen. It’s gentle on the screen and can effectively remove dirt and dust.
- Distilled Water: Distilled water is recommended for cleaning your LG Smart TV screen. Tap water can contain minerals that can leave streaks and spots on the screen.
- Screen Cleaning Solution (Optional): If you want to use a screen cleaning solution, make sure it’s specifically designed for cleaning TVs and is free of ammonia and other harsh chemicals.
- Soft, Dry Cloth: A soft, dry cloth can be used to wipe away any excess moisture from the screen.
Step-by-Step Guide to Cleaning Your LG Smart TV Screen
Now that you have the necessary materials, let’s move on to the step-by-step guide to cleaning your LG Smart TV screen:
- Turn Off Your LG Smart TV: Before you start cleaning your LG Smart TV screen, make sure it’s turned off. This will prevent any accidental start-ups or electrical shocks.
- Remove Any Loose Debris: Use a soft, dry cloth to remove any loose debris, such as dust or dirt, from the screen.
- Dampen a Microfiber Cloth: Dampen a microfiber cloth with distilled water. Make sure the cloth is not soaking wet, as this can damage the screen.
- Wipe the Screen Gently: Wipe the screen gently with the damp microfiber cloth. Start from the top and work your way down to prevent any streaks or drips.
- Use a Screen Cleaning Solution (Optional): If you’re using a screen cleaning solution, apply it to the microfiber cloth and wipe the screen gently.
- Wipe Away Excess Moisture: Use a soft, dry cloth to wipe away any excess moisture from the screen.
- Inspect the Screen: Inspect the screen to make sure it’s clean and free of streaks or spots.
Tips and Precautions to Keep in Mind
Here are some tips and precautions to keep in mind when cleaning your LG Smart TV screen:
- Avoid Using Harsh Chemicals: Avoid using harsh chemicals, such as ammonia or bleach, to clean your LG Smart TV screen. These chemicals can damage the screen or harm your health.
- Never Use Paper Towels: Paper towels can scratch the screen or leave behind lint. Instead, use a microfiber cloth to clean your LG Smart TV screen.
- Avoid Spraying Cleaning Solutions Directly on the Screen: Avoid spraying cleaning solutions directly on the screen. Instead, apply the solution to the microfiber cloth and wipe the screen gently.
- Don’t Use Excessive Water: Avoid using excessive water to clean your LG Smart TV screen. This can damage the screen or harm the electrical components.

Can I use a paper towel to clean my LG Smart TV screen?
No, it’s not recommended to use a paper towel to clean your LG Smart TV screen. Paper towels can be abrasive and can scratch the screen or leave behind lint or fibers. Additionally, paper towels can be too rough for the screen’s coating and can damage it.
Instead, use a microfiber cloth to clean your LG Smart TV screen. Microfiber cloths are gentle and effective at cleaning the screen without leaving streaks or residue. They are also machine washable and can be reused multiple times, making them a convenient and eco-friendly option.
